“Nice people, nice hotel”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ed 17 March 2010

My daughter and her friends spent the night here last week enroute to Florida for spring break. They had two rooms on the fifth floor next to one another. Got the rooms on Priceline for $59 each. Very convenient to RiverChase Mall. They also said that the staff were extremely nice to them. One person traveling with my daughter said it was the best bed they had ever slept in in their whole life. Did self park for $9. Wouldn't hesitate to stay here again.

“Very nice hotel with with great shopping opportunities.”
4 of 5 stars Reviewed 13 March 2010

My wife had a convention and we stayed here two nights. Our stay was relatively uneventful.
The hotel is in The Galleria so there was plenty to do during the day. The beds were very comfortable. Rooms were clean. We got a good convention rate so I felt it was very reasonable for this nice of a hotel.
The concierge got us reservations at a nice restaurant downtown as well as he called for a cab to get us there. Everything went real smooth.
The only negative I would have is I had to pay $9.95 per day for internet access. For this class of a hotel I would expect internet to be included. However, I was wrong.
Overall, we really enjoyed our stay and was very satisfied with this hotel. We will certainly return for future conventions as well.

“Great Location, Great Service”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ed 8 February 2010

If you're looking for another cookie-cutter type of hotel in Birmingham, this hotel isn't for you. If you're looking for a unique hotel that is grand, has class, has a good location south of Downtown, then you found it in the Wynfrey hotel.

This is a big hotel with lots of glass, brass, and marble. It is grand in every sense of the word. It can seem a little dated when comparing to newer hotels, but I didn't mind that. I was interested in the location for the business I had nearby. It has easy access to I-459 and I-65, as well as US31 Montgomery Highway, so for me it was easy to find.

Inside, the sleeping rooms are large and they have, in my opinion, the most comfortable hotel beds I have ever slept in. And I mean better than the big brand hotels too. Other comforts included the concierge club on the top 2 floors. I paid a little extra for the upgrade, but it included breakfast and evening hors doeveres. The Concierge who works there in the morning is super friendly and attentive. There is also a Shula's steakhouse in the hotel, which is second to none for service and food. Room service was also good, and I think some of the same items on the Shulas menu was available from room service. Every employee I walked past was friendly and said hello or something, which was impressive. That's not always the case in some hotels.

I did have to pay for parking and internet access.

If you like to shop or just walk around malls, this hotel is connected to the Riverchase Galleria mall.
